Choosing the Right Bed

When choosing a bed for your cat, there are a few things to keep in mind. First, consider the size of your cat. If you have a large cat, make sure to choose a bed that is big enough for them to stretch out comfortably. Second, consider the material of the bed. Some cats prefer soft, plush beds, while others prefer beds made of natural materials like wool or cotton. Finally, consider the shape of the bed. Cats love to curl up in cozy spaces, so a bed with high sides or a hooded design might be a good choice.

Once you’ve chosen the right bed for your cat, it’s important to place it in the right location. Cats like to sleep in quiet, cozy spots, so consider placing the bed in a corner or a quiet area of your home. Avoid placing the bed in high-traffic areas or near loud appliances like the TV or washing machine.

Cleaning and Maintaining the Bed

To keep your cat’s bed clean and comfortable, it’s important to clean it regularly. Wash any blankets or pillows in the bed on a regular basis, and vacuum the bed itself to remove any hair or debris. If the bed is made of natural materials like wool or cotton, consider using a natural cleaner like vinegar or baking soda to clean it.

In addition to regular cleaning, it’s important to maintain the bed and replace it when necessary. If the bed becomes worn or damaged, it may no longer be providing your cat with the comfort and support they need. Consider replacing the bed every few years to ensure your cat always has a comfortable place to sleep.

Can I make a cat bed without sewing?

Yes, you can make a cat bed without sewing by using materials such as fleece, cardboard, or a basket. To make a simple cat bed using fleece, cut a piece of fleece to the desired size, and fold it in half. Then, use scissors to cut fringe along the edges of the fleece, and tie the fringe pieces together to create a knot. This will create a cozy and soft bed for your cat.

Another option is to use a cardboard box or basket, and line it with soft and comfortable bedding, such as a blanket or towel. This will provide a simple and cozy sleeping area for your cat, without the need for sewing or complicated construction.
